Prime accused in Mamita Meher homicide case dies by suicide in Kantabanji sub-jail

3 min read

By Express News Service

BALANGIR: The prime accused within the sensational Mamita Meher homicide case Gobinda Sahu has allegedly died by suicide contained in the Kantabanji sub-jail earlier than showing earlier than the court docket of judicial Justice of the Peace top notch (JMFC) on Tuesday morning.

Sources say that Sahu was discovered hanging bottom of the cell the place he was saved together with different under-trial prisoners. He was instantly rushed to a close-by hospital the place medical doctors declared him lifeless. 

While jail officers are tight-lipped in regards to the incident, police have began inquiring into the alleged suicide.

Northern Range IG Deepak Kumar confirmed that Sahu’s reason for demise was suicide. He additionally stated that additional investigation is on.

Sahu was the primary accused within the homicide of Mamita, a instructor at Sunshine English Medium School in Mahaling. He was the president of the college. This was one of many stunning instances that occurred in October. It is alleged that Sahu murdered the instructor, torched her physique and buried it within the playground close to the college. 

Sahu was presupposed to be produced earlier than JMFC court docket on the day in reference to the trial of the homicide case. Already 10 witnesses have been examined thus far and the prosecution was positive to realize conviction within the case. 

Kantabaji police had registered a separate case towards Sahu for threatening a witness. He had not too long ago moved the High Court looking for bail, however his plea was rejected.

“Sahu possibly felt that there was no way to escape from stringent punishment. That’s why he might have taken the extreme step inside the jail. Further probe is on,” stated a jail officer.

DIG of Prison Range Sambalpur Anusaya Jena is on her option to Kantabanji to conduct an enquiry and submit a report following which additional motion might be taken if mandatory.

After a police grievance, Sahu was detained however escaped from the Titlagarh police station earlier than he received arrested the subsequent day.

The situation snowballed into an enormous political controversy because the Opposition alleged MLA Dibya Shankar Mishra’s function within the homicide and demanded his resignation from the Cabinet. However, the Odisha Government didn’t give in to it.
